对最新修订的GB 50010—2010《混凝土结构设计规范》裂缝宽度验算公式进行变换,首先提出用一新的正截面承载力计算中的纵向受拉钢筋配筋率、钢筋应力和钢筋直径的关系曲线代替常用的按有效受拉混凝土截面面积计算的纵向受拉钢筋配筋率、钢筋应力和钢筋直径的关系曲线;接着给出了结构设计时参考图表和应该注意的内容;最后提出钢筋混凝土受弯构件不需作裂缝宽度验算的最大钢筋直径的统一调整公式。在设计配筋时,只需计算出钢筋应力查表或根据调整公式就可以判定所选钢筋是否满足规范对裂缝宽度限值的要求。
